Atlanta Dream guard Tiffany Hayes was named the WNBA Eastern Conference Player of the Week for her performance during the week of July 30-Aug. 5.

Earning her third Player of the Week honor this season, Hayes led the Eastern Conference in scoring last week, averaging 21.7 points, three rebounds and two assists.

The former Connecticut Husky also shot 53.3 percent from the field and 47.6 beyond the arc as the Dream went 2-1 over the past seven days.

Hayes shared Player of the Week honors with Los Angeles Sparks forward Candace Parker who was named WNBA Western Conference Player of the Week for her performance from July 30 through Aug. 5.
